  • R. H. Whittaker proposed the five-kingdom classification including Monera, Protista, Fungi, Plantae, and Animalia.
  • The kingdom Monera is considered the most primitive group.
  • These organisms are unicellular prokaryotes that do not have membrane-bound cell organelles such as the nucleus, mitochondria, chloroplasts, etc.
